I will have to respectfully disagree with some of the other reviewers here. As someone who cannot have gluten or casein, I often have difficulty finding good cereals. Unfortunately, Arrowhead Mills' Organic Maple Buckwheat Flakes continued that trend for me.

Some of my complaints about this cereal are common to many -- it gets soggy quickly, it's very expensive for its size, its nutritional value could be better. What really bothers me, however, is the almost metallic aftertaste it leaves. Although the ingredients say that it is made with natural maple flavoring, my refined New England maple tastes do not find this flavor to be anything familiar. It is very strong and very unpleasant. I found that I have had to brush my teeth immediately after eating each bowl just to get the aftertaste out of my mouth.

I usually like Arrowhead Mills products, but this one misses the mark for me. I'll finish the box, but I won't be buying it again.

I really like this cereal, it stays crunchy in milk and is more filling than some other gluten free cereals I have tried. It has a hint of sweetness and smells like maple syrup but is not too sweet like some cereals. Buckwheat does have a unique taste, so go in open minded, some people who go gluten free seem to chase that elusive wheat like cereal instead of opening up their minds and taste buds to absolutely new adventures - leave expectations behind and enjoy a great tasty treat for breakfast!

My 10 year-old son can't have gluten, which makes most breakfast cereals a no-go. However, he really likes these, and I'm okay with them as well. They are made with organic ingredients, are low in sugar, and provide daily fiber. They also stay really crunchy in milk. They aren't his number one favorite, hence only giving them 4 stars, but he does eat them happily when that is the available choice. Personally, I think they are rather cardboard-like and much prefer the Arrowhead Mills Sweetened Brown Rice Flakes which aren't quite as thick.
